Transaction 71e6a83ebc2f1754f413d9e1f1aa2aed28e150232650630ddc61169798fd162b
1 Input
1 Output
-
71e6a83ebc2f1754f413d9e1f1aa2aed28e150232650630ddc61169798fd162b:0
- value
- 26543893
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ec1042c23d37b87908f2a2850d453a1a7c36629 OP_EQUAL
- address
- 3AL2fandLA9QpH5tcHPdKmw1s5q72M3UKt